Ingredients:

200g dried noodles
100g shrimp, peeled and deveined
1 zucchini, sliced into thin strips
100g mushrooms, sliced into thin strips
2 cloves garlic, minced
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
2 tablespoons soy sauce
1 teaspoon sesame oil
Salt and pepper to taste

Cooking Instructions:

Bring a pot of water to a boil over high heat. Add the noodles and cook for 8-10 minutes or until al dente. Drain the noodles and set aside.
Heat the v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the shrimp and cook for 3-4 minutes or until cooked through. Remove the shrimp from the skillet and set aside.
Add the zucchini and mushrooms to the skillet and cook for 3-4 minutes or until softened. Add the garlic and cook for an additional minute or until fragrant.
Return the cooked noodles to the skillet along with the cooked shrimp, soy sauce, sesame oil, salt and pepper to taste.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es or until everything is heated through. Serve immediately.
